The smoke chamber is the area above your firebox where smoke and gases collect before entering the flue. Properly shaped and sealed smoke chambers ensure good draft, prevent creosote buildup in crevices, and protect combustible materials from heat.
Signs include visible cracks, exposed mortar joints, rough corbelled brick surfaces, or previous chimney fires. Our video inspection during certified chimney inspection provides clear evidence of smoke chamber condition.

Professionally applied resurfacing using quality materials typically lasts 20-30+ years with proper maintenance. This is a long-term investment in your chimney’s safety and performance.
